What is Energy Efficiency?

Energy effectiveness describes using much less energy to supply the exact same solution or achieve the exact same outcome. For instance, if an old fridge consumes 800 kWh each year while a brand-new model only utilizes 400 kWh for similar storage capacities, the last is taken into consideration more energy-efficient.

Understanding Appliance Life expectancy and Efficiency Ratings

Lifespan Assumptions for Usual Appliances

Every device has a basic life-span:

|Appliance|Average Life expectancy|| -------------------|------------------|| Fridge|10-- two decades|| Washing Machine|10-- 15 years|| Dishwasher|7-- 12 years|| Clothes dryer|10-- 15 years|

Knowing these lifespans helps establish whether it deserves repairing or changing a device based on its age and condition.

Energy Star Rankings: What You Need to Know

The Power Star tag shows that a device meets stringent power effectiveness standards set by the united state Environmental Protection Agency (EPA). Picking Energy Star-rated appliances can result in significant financial savings over time.

Repair vs. Replacement: Making Informed Choices

When confronted with a malfunctioning home appliance, numerous home owners question if they must repair it or spend for a new one.

Questions to Think about:

  1. How old is the appliance?
  2. What are the repair service prices compared to replacement?
  3. How a lot will I save on my energy expenses if I switch?

In most situations, if a home appliance is reasonably brand-new and repair expenses are practical (around 50% or much less than replacement), going with repair makes economic sense.
